Помилка синтаксису "import SYS invalid syntax" - одна з найпоширеніших проблем, з якою стикаються новачки та досвідчені розробники під час роботи з мовою програмування Python. Дана помилка виникає, коли в коді виявляється невірний синтаксис при спробі імпортувати модуль sys.
Модуль Sys в Python є стандартним модулем, що надає доступ до деяких змінних і функцій, які взаємодіють безпосередньо з інтерпретатором Python. Він широко використовується для роботи з аргументами командного рядка, управління оточенням виконання програми та інших системних завдань.
Однією з основних причин виникнення помилки "import sys invalid syntax" є неправильне написання самого рядка імпорту. Важливо переконатися, що ключове слово "import" написано правильно, а після нього йде ім'я модуля "sys" без помилок. Також необхідно звернути увагу на наявність пробілів або інших символів, які можуть спотворити синтаксис імпорту.
Що таке помилка синтаксису Python import SYS invalid syntax?
Помилка синтаксису Python import sys invalid syntax виникає, коли інтерпретатор Python не може розпізнати або правильно обробити команду import sys . Команда import використовується в Python для імпорту модулів або бібліотек, і помилка синтаксису виникає, коли синтаксичне правило для команди import порушено.
Найчастіше, помилка import SYS invalid syntax виникає з наступних причин:
- Відсутність правильного синтаксису для команди import . У Python команда import повинна бути написана як import, де-ім'я імпортованого модуля або бібліотеки.
- Невірно вказано ім'я модуля або бібліотеки. Якщо вказане ім'я модуля або бібліотеки не існує, буде згенерована помилка синтаксису import SYS invalid syntax .
- Відсутність необхідного модуля або бібліотеки. Якщо вказаний модуль або бібліотека не встановлені або не доступні в поточному оточенні, може бути згенерована помилка синтаксису import SYS invalid syntax .
Для виправлення помилки синтаксису import SYS invalid syntax необхідно:
- Перевірити правильність написання команди import sys . Переконайтеся, що вона написана без помилок і відповідно до синтаксичних правил Python.
- Перевірити наявність вказаного модуля або бібліотеки. Якщо модуль або бібліотека не встановлені, встановіть їх за допомогою менеджера пакетів, такого як pip.
- Переконатися, що модуль або бібліотека доступні в поточному оточенні. Перевірте, що вони встановлені в правильне місце і правильно налаштовані.
Виправлення помилки import SYS invalid syntax часто зводиться до правильного написання команди import і встановлення або налаштування необхідних модулів або бібліотек. Уважне вивчення повідомлень про помилки і перевірка оточення допоможуть вирішити цю проблему.
Чому виникає помилка синтаксису Python import SYS invalid syntax?
Помилка синтаксису Python import SYS invalid syntax виникає, коли в коді програми є неправильне використання ключового слова import або невідповідність правилам мови Python.
Можливі причини помилки синтаксису import SYS invalid syntax можуть бути наступними:
| 1. | Пропущена або неправильно вказана крапка з комою (;) в попередньому виразі або інструкції перед рядком з import sys . |
| 2. | Замість ключового слова import було використано щось інше (наприклад, помилка в назві змінної або функції). |
| 3. | Рядок з import sys був неправильно відформатований або розташований всередині блоку коду, який не дозволяє такі інструкції. |
| 4. | Синтаксична помилка в іншому місці коду, що призводить до неправильної обробки рядка з import sys . |
Для виправлення помилки import SYS invalid syntax рекомендується:
- Перевірте попередні рядки коду на наявність синтаксичних помилок та правильне використання роздільників (крапка з комою).
- Переконатися, що в рядку з import sys не допущені помилки, і ключове слово import використовується коректно.
- Перемістити рядок з import sys у відповідне місце в блоці коду, де інструкції import допускаються.
- При необхідності, звернутися до документації мови Python або звернутися за допомогою до спільноти розробників Python.
У будь-якому випадку, помилка синтаксису import SYS invalid syntax є типовою і часто зустрічається помилкою при програмуванні на мові Python. Її виправлення зазвичай вимагає уважного аналізу коду і пошук місця, де допущена помилка.
Як виправити помилку синтаксису Python import SYS invalid syntax?
Помилка синтаксису "import sys invalid syntax" може виникнути при спробі імпортування модуля sys в програмі на мові Python. Ця помилка зазвичай виникає з наступних причин:
| Причина | Рішення |
|---|---|
| Відсутність ключового слова "import" | Переконайтеся, що перед "sys" є ключове слово "import". Наприклад, замість" import sys invalid syntax "використовуйте"import sys". |
| Відсутність або неправильне використання знаків пунктуації | Якщо після "sys" є неправильні або пропущені знаки пунктуації, виправте їх. Перевірте наявність точок, ком, дужок та лапок у потрібних місцях. |
| Помилки в іншій частині програми | Якщо помилка виникає не тільки під час імпорту модуля sys, але й в інших місцях програми, Перевірте весь код на наявність інших помилок синтаксису. |
Якщо ви виправили всі синтаксичні помилки, але помилка "import SYS invalid syntax" все ще залишається, можливо, у вас виникають проблеми з установкою Python або середовищем виконання. Спробуйте перевстановити Python або скористатися іншим середовищем виконання Python, щоб виправити цю помилку.
Запам'ятайте, що правильний синтаксис є ключовим для успішної роботи програми на Python. Зверніть увагу на повідомлення про помилки, які видає інтерпретатор, щоб швидко визначити та виправити синтаксичні помилки.
Перевірте правильність написання коду
Помилка синтаксису Python import SYS invalid syntax може виникати через неправильного написання коду. При написанні імпорту модуля, слід переконатися, що код написаний правильно і без помилок.
Можливі причини помилки можуть бути:
- Відсутність пробілу після ключового слова import .
- Відсутність правильно вказаного імені модуля. Перевірте, чи модуль, який ви намагаєтесь імпортувати, існує та доступний для використання.
- Помилки в назві модуля. Переконайтеся, що ви правильно вказали назву модуля, включаючи регістр символів.
Для виправлення помилки перевірте свій код і переконайтеся, що він правильно написаний і не містить описаних вище проблем. Також зверніть увагу на навколишній код, можливо, там є інші синтаксичні помилки, які можуть впливати на роботу імпорту модуля.
Переконайтеся, що ви використовуєте правильну версію Python
Однією з причин виникнення помилки синтаксису import sys invalid syntax може бути використання непідтримуваної версії Python.
Python постійно розвивається, і нові функціональні можливості та вдосконалення додаються до кожного оновлення. Кожна версія Python має свої синтаксичні особливості та інструкції.
Якщо ви зіткнулися з помилкою синтаксису під час використання інструкції import sys, переконайтеся, що ваша встановлена версія Python підтримує цю інструкцію.
Ви можете перевірити свою поточну версію Python, виконавши таку команду в командному рядку:
Якщо ваша встановлена версія Python нижча за необхідну, Вам потрібно оновити її до підтримуваної версії. Дотримуйтесь офіційних інструкцій щодо встановлення та оновлення Python для вашої операційної системи.
Не забудьте перевірити сумісність усіх використовуваних бібліотек та модулів з вашою версією Python. Деякі старіші версії бібліотек можуть не працювати або спричиняти помилки синтаксису в нових версіях Python.
Перевірка та використання правильної версії Python допоможе вам уникнути помилок синтаксису та забезпечить більш плавну роботу ваших програм.
Перевірте використовувані модулі та бібліотеки
Якщо ви отримуєте помилку синтаксису Python import SYS invalid syntax, однією з можливих причин може бути неправильно вказаний модуль або бібліотека. Необхідно переконатися, що ви правильно вказуєте ім'я модуля і його синтаксис при імпорті.
При імпорті модуля або бібліотеки в Python необхідно враховувати наступні моменти:
- Перевірте правильність написання імені модуля або бібліотеки. Переконайтеся, що ви не допустили друкарську помилку або неправильне написання імені.
- Переконайтеся, що модуль або бібліотека встановлені у вашому середовищі розробки або на вашому комп'ютері. Якщо модуль або бібліотека не встановлені, їх можна встановити за допомогою інструменту управління пакетами, такого як pip.
- Якщо ви використовуєте сторонні модулі або бібліотеки, переконайтеся, що вони сумісні з вашою версією Python. Деякі модулі можуть бути доступні лише для певних версій Python, тому перевірте сумісність.
- Перевірте, що шлях до модуля або бібліотеці вказано коректно. Переконайтеся, що ви правильно вказуєте шлях до модуля або бібліотеки під час імпорту.
- Якщо ви використовуєте віртуальне середовище Python, переконайтеся, що ви активували це середовище перед запуском сценарію. Іноді проблеми з імпортом можуть виникати через неправильні налаштування віртуального середовища.
Перевірте всі вищезазначені моменти та переконайтеся, що ви правильно вказуєте модулі та бібліотеки під час імпорту. Якщо помилка синтаксису Python import SYS invalid syntax все ще виникає, зверніться до документації модуля або бібліотеки, щоб дізнатися більше інформації про правильне використання їх імпорту.